New Finds of Yuan Dynasty Blue-and-White Porcelain from the Luomaqiao Kiln Site, Jingdezhen: An Archaeological Approach
The Period of Yuan dynasty (1279-1368 AD) is an important historic time for both the cultural and material exchange of China and the West Asia, and the ceramic industry of Jingdezhen city. During that period, along with its absorption of outside craftsmanship and culture, Jingdezhen's ceramic technology and products reached their peak and thus founded a solid base for the birth and development of the brilliant blue-and-white porcelains. From Nov. 2012 through Dec. 2015, in order to cope with the infrastructural development of Jingdezhen city, the author worked as the executive director of an archaeological team for the excavation project of Luomaqiao ancient kiln site in the township area. Consequently, a great number of ceramic industry remains and tons of porcelain shards, dating from the Northern Song dynasty (960-1127 AD) through the Late Qing dynasty(1636-1911 AD), were found at the site. Among them, the Yuan blue-and-white pieces are of the most valuable ones in terms of arts and stories. On the basis of an academic review of the kiln sites and porcelain products of Jingdezhen in the Yuan dynasty, the book mainly covers the following works. First of all, in a matter of archaeological typology and with full illustrations, this book introduces all the categories and typical samples of the Yuan blue-and-white porcelains found at the Luomaqiao site. Secondly, with the application and analysis of a large-scale of statistical data and scientific tests on the unearthed wares, the book contributes a reliable and detailed database for further studies on the product structure, firing method and decoration techniques of the Yuan blue-and-white porcelains. Lastly, combined together with literature and archaeological findings on other sites, the book explored the origin, material, manufacturing period, product structure, and markets of Yuan blue-and-white porcelains, and furthermore the system of Yuan official kilns.

As public attention on energy conservation and emission reduction has increased in recent years, engine idling has become a growing concern due to its low efficiency and high emissions. Service vehicles equipped with auxiliary systems, such as refrigeration, air conditioning, PCs, and electronics, usually have to idle to power them. The number of service vehicles (e.g. public-school-tour buses, delivery-refrigerator trucks, police cars, ambulances, armed vehicles, firefighter vehicles) is increasing significantly with tremendous social development. Therefore, introducing new anti-idling solutions is inevitably vital for controlling energy unsustainability and poor air quality. There are a few books about the idling disadvantages and anti-idling solutions. Most of them are more concerned with different anti-idling technologies and their effects on the society rather than elaborating an anti-idling system design considering different applications and limitations. There is still much room to improve existing anti-idling technologies and products. In this book, we took a service vehicle, refrigerator truck, as an example to demonstrate the whole process of designing, optimizing, controlling, and developing a smart charging system for the anti-idling purpose. The proposed system cannot only electrify the auxiliary systems to achieve anti-idling, but also utilize the concepts of regenerative braking and optimal charging strategy to arrive at an optimum solution. Necessary tools, algorithms, and methods are illustrated and the benefits of the optimal anti-idling solution are evaluated.

Thanks to the potential of reducing fuel consumption and emissions, hybrid electric vehicles (HEVs) have been attracting more and more attention from car manufacturers and researchers. Due to involving two energy sources, i.e., engine and battery, the powertrain in HEVs is a complicated electromechanical coupling system that generates noise and vibration different from that of a traditional vehicle. Accordingly, it is very important to explore the noise and vibration characteristics of HEVs. In this book, a hybrid vehicle with two motors is taken as an example, consisting of a compound planetary gear set (CPGS) as the power-split device, to analyze the noise and vibration characteristics. It is specifically intended for graduates and anyone with an interest in the electrification of full hybrid vehicles. The book begins with the research background and significance of the HEV. The second chapter presents the structural description and working principal of the target hybrid vehicle. Chapter 3 highlights the noise, vibration, and harshness (NVH) tests and corresponding analysis of the hybrid powertrain. Chapter 4 provides transmission system parameters and meshing stiffness calculation. Chapter 5 discusses the mathematical modeling and analyzes torsional vibration (TV) of HEVs. Finally, modeling of the hybrid powertrain with ADAMS is given in Chapter 6.

IEEE 802.11ba Discover the latest developments in IEEE 802.11ba and Wake-up Radios In IEEE 802.11ba: Ultra-Low Power Wake-up Radio Standard, expert engineers Drs. Steve Shellhammer, Alfred Asterjadhi, and Yanjun Sun deliver a detailed discussion of the IEEE 802.11ba standard. The book begins by explaining the concept of a wake-up radio (WUR) and how it fits into the overall 802.11 standard, as well as how a WUR saves power and extends battery life. The authors go on to describe the medium access control (MAC) layer in detail and then talk about the various protocols used to negotiate WUR operation, its uses for different functionalities (like wake up of the main radio, discovery, synchronization, and security). The book offers a detailed description of the physical (PHY) layer packet construction and the rationale for the design, as well as the various design aspects of the medium access control layer. It also includes: A thorough introduction to the motivations driving the development of the WUR in 802.11 Practical overviews of IEEE 802.11, including the basic concepts of 802.11 (the PHY and MAC) and background material on current low power modes Comprehensive discussions of the physical layer and PHY layer performance, including the generic receiver, the PPDU, Transmit Diversity, and the FDMA mode In-depth examinations of the medium access layer and its frame designs Perfect for professional wireless engineers, IEEE 802.11ba: Ultra-Low Power Wake-up Radio Standard will also earn a place in the libraries of academics and students researching and studying in fields involving wireless communications.

2019 is the 100th anniversary of the establishment of the Yanjing University (aka Yenching University), a Christian college that was established in 1919 by John Leighton Stuart. As well known as it had been, however, the university was short lived and had only been in operation for thirty-three years. This book reveals the ill-fated truth of the university and its faculty members including my father, Zhao Chengxin, who was the head of the Faculty of Law at Yanjing University and the dean of the Department of Sociology. He was one of the early sociologists in China who contributed his lifetime's hard work to sociology.

In Touring China, Yajun Mo explores how early twentieth century Chinese sightseers described the destinations that they visited, and how their travel accounts gave Chinese readers a means to imagine their vast country. The roots of China's tourism market stretch back over a hundred years, when railroad and steamship networks expanded into the coastal regions. Tourism-related businesses and publications flourished in urban centers while scientific exploration, investigative journalism, and wartime travel propelled many Chinese from the eastern seaboard to its peripheries. Mo considers not only accounts of overseas travel and voyages across borderlands, but also trips within China. On the one hand, via travel and travel writing, the unity of China's coastal regions, inland provinces, and western frontiers was experienced and reinforced. On the other, travel literature revealed a persistent tension between the aspiration for national unity and the anxiety that China might fall apart. Touring China tells a fascinating story about the physical and intellectual routes people took on various journeys, against the backdrop of the transition from Chinese empire to nation-state.
